Output 9d33609a56830866d1baba53f1309780bb85ff8ca59ce0b41e310240b038c3ca:12

value
169113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8a511761222a75d3f64576d68bcc8c49cc8e87 OP_EQUAL
address
3MtQxMZzSaA4jhsxMVsSv8WKsPnnGEE5Vw
transaction
9d33609a56830866d1baba53f1309780bb85ff8ca59ce0b41e310240b038c3ca
spent
true